ABC Extends 'High Potential' for a Third Run

ABC has announced that its series 'High Potential' will return for a third season. The show has reportedly been gaining traction among its audience since its previous renewals. Notably, this renewal represents the final series from ABC Signature before its integration into 20th Television.

Context

'High Potential' is a series produced by ABC Signature, which is set to merge with 20th Television. The show has seen increased viewership since its earlier seasons, suggesting a solid fan base. The integration of production companies may impact future programming decisions and content offerings.
